1 From 575145094f904ca3c50e07f69a4ffaea902eadd7 Mon Sep 17 00:00:00 2001
2 From: Phil Elwell <phil@raspberrypi.org>
3 Date: Tue, 11 Jun 2019 18:08:05 +0100
4 Subject: [PATCH 671/703] arm: dts: First draft of upstream Pi4 DTS
5
6 I've attempted to follow the upstream conventions in the DT commits,
7 but this is just presented here initially as a talking point.
8
9 Signed-off-by: Phil Elwell <phil@raspberrypi.org>
10 ---
11  arch/arm/boot/dts/Makefile            |   1 +
12  arch/arm/boot/dts/bcm2838-rpi-4-b.dts | 118 ++++++++++++++++++++++++++
13  arch/arm/boot/dts/bcm2838-rpi.dtsi    |  25 ++++++
14  3 files changed, 144 insertions(+)
15  create mode 100644 arch/arm/boot/dts/bcm2838-rpi-4-b.dts
16  create mode 100644 arch/arm/boot/dts/bcm2838-rpi.dtsi
